One English food that begins with the letter "X" is "xmas pudding," commonly known as Christmas pudding. This traditional dessert is made with a mixture of dried fruits, nuts, and spices, and is typically steamed or boiled. It is often served during the Christmas season, usually with a sprig of holly on top and sometimes flambéed with brandy before serving.
